Li occupies higher position in the electrochemical series of metals as compared to Cu since

Options

(a) the standard reduction potential Li⁺/Li is lower than that of Cu²⁺/Cu
(b) the standard reduction potential of Cu²⁺/Cu is lower than that of Li⁺/Li
(c) the standard oxidation potential of Li/Li⁺ is lower than that of Cu/Cu²⁺
(d) Li is smaller in size as compared to Cu

Correct Answer:

the standard reduction potential Li⁺/Li is lower than that of Cu²⁺/Cu
